Housing Market

Rent & Property
1 Bedroom$900/mo
2 Bedrooms$1200/mo
3 Bedrooms$1800/mo
Median Home Price$220,000
Property Tax Rate1.05%
Avg Childcare/mo$800

The housing market in Morris is relatively affordable, with a mix of older and newer homes available. Rentals are also available, but options may be limited. Home prices have been steadily increasing over the past few years.

☀️ Seasonal Utility Costs

Summer months bring higher electricity bills due to air conditioning usage, while winter months see a slight increase in natural gas usage for heating. However, since most homes in Morris use electric heat, the winter increase is relatively minimal.
